History - The Greenville Textile Heritage Society
http://scmillhills.com/mills/camperdown/history
The Camperdown Mills were the first of the modern textile mills to be opened within the corporate boundaries of the City of Greenville and the first in Greenville county whose principal purpose was to manufacture and export cotton yarns to other areas of the United States. A mill village of what eventually would include 119 homes and a boarding house was started soon afterwards on property adjacent to Camperdown #2. In 1903 Charles E. Graham, owner of the local Huguenot Mill, purchased the Camperdown...

Home
Skip to main content. The hoarse steam whistle of the great engine of Camperdown Cotton Mills tells of a utilitarian age and modern progress.". The Greenville Century Book. C S Crittenden, 1903. Were located on the banks of the Reedy River on the south side of the Main Street Bridge in the area now known as Falls Park in Greenville. The Camperdown Mills Company was established in 1874 and operated the first mills in Greenville County set up to export cotton products to other areas of the United States.
